Output 5ae24b59de072fce040b68d1b7998f02a49c8f149fdf798effcc7d98d7a08680:2

value
50999
script pubkey
OP_0 OP_PUSHBYTES_20 df73d8c7179a782001bb785594e3c4cb3a24dcf7
address
bc1qmaea33chnfuzqqdm0p2efc7yevazfh8hg5msml
transaction
5ae24b59de072fce040b68d1b7998f02a49c8f149fdf798effcc7d98d7a08680
confirmations
104143
spent
false